Athletistic/Tennis. Russians Veronika Kudermetova and Anastasia Pavlyuchenkova won the Rome tournament in doubles.
In the final, they beat Gabriela Dabrowski of Canada and Juliana Olmos of Mexico 1:6, 6:4, 10:7. The athletes spent 1 hour and 17 minutes on the field.
